Transaction 17e4ad43394331464282665a6a53687c30e0d8eef84adf7ebe8a9a41bb7a2d4e
1 Input
1 Output
-
17e4ad43394331464282665a6a53687c30e0d8eef84adf7ebe8a9a41bb7a2d4e:0
- value
- 159146
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6fcafbc6855cff80543a73aeef71bf6996ba0235 OP_EQUAL
- address
- 3Bt86NrZdjuLr7N63F1zuZir9VMHoYndwF